Predicting the Outcome of the Next Mets vs. Marlins Series

Alright guys, let's talk about the future – specifically, the next Mets vs. Marlins series! Predicting the outcome of any baseball game, let alone a whole series, is like trying to catch lightning in a bottle, but that's what makes it so much fun, right? We've gotta look at a bunch of factors to even try and guess who's going to come out on top. First off, who's pitching? The starting pitching matchup is HUGE. If the Mets are sending out their top aces against the Marlins' number three or four starter, that's a significant advantage for New York. Conversely, if the Marlins have their bullpen fully rested and ready to go, they can really shut down any late-game rallies the Mets might try to mount. We also need to consider recent team performance. Is one team on a hot streak, winning their last five or six games? Or are they struggling, dropping games they should be winning? Momentum plays a massive role in baseball, and a team that's feeling good is a dangerous opponent.

Injuries are another big one. Is a key player on either team sidelined? Losing your cleanup hitter or your ace closer can completely shift the balance of power. We also can't forget about the ballpark factor. Some ballparks are notorious for favoring hitters (think cozy outfields), while others are pitcher's paradises. While both the Mets and Marlins play in parks that are relatively neutral, subtle differences can still come into play. We also need to consider the head-to-head record between the two teams for the season. If one team has dominated the other so far, there might be a psychological edge that carries over.
